本文目录导读:
随着互联网的飞速发展,PHP作为一门广泛应用于网站开发的语言,深受广大开发者的喜爱,一个精美的PHP个人网站源码不仅能够展示个人风采,还能提高用户体验,就让我们一起来揭秘这个精美PHP个人网站源码的奥秘。
网站结构
这个精美PHP个人网站源码采用了MVC(Model-View-Controller)模式,将网站分为模型、视图和控制器三层,使得代码结构清晰、易于维护,以下是网站的主要结构:
1、模型(Model):负责数据的处理和操作,包括数据库连接、数据查询、数据更新等。
2、视图(View):负责数据的展示,包括HTML页面、CSS样式和JavaScript脚本等。
图片来源于网络,如有侵权联系删除
3、控制器(Controller):负责接收用户请求,调用模型和视图完成响应。
技术栈
该网站采用了以下技术栈:
1、PHP:作为后端开发语言,负责处理业务逻辑和数据交互。
2、MySQL:作为数据库,存储网站数据。
3、HTML5、CSS3、JavaScript:作为前端技术,负责页面展示和交互。
4、Bootstrap:作为前端框架,提供响应式布局和丰富的组件。
5、jQuery:作为JavaScript库,简化DOM操作和事件处理。
6、Ajax:实现前后端数据交互,提高用户体验。
特色功能
1、个人博客:展示个人生活、工作、学习等方面的内容。
图片来源于网络,如有侵权联系删除
2、作品展示:展示个人作品,包括代码、设计、摄影等。
3、技术分享:分享个人在编程、设计、生活等方面的经验。
4、联系方式:提供联系方式,方便用户沟通交流。
5、社交分享:集成微博、微信等社交平台,方便用户分享内容。
6、留言板:用户可以留言,与博主互动。
代码优化
1、代码规范:遵循PSR标准,保证代码的可读性和可维护性。
2、数据库优化:采用ORM(对象关系映射)技术,简化数据库操作,提高效率。
3、缓存机制:使用Redis等缓存技术,减少数据库访问,提高网站性能。
4、响应式设计:适配多种设备,提高用户体验。
图片来源于网络,如有侵权联系删除
5、安全性:对用户输入进行过滤和验证,防止SQL注入、XSS攻击等安全问题。
下载与使用
1、下载:将网站源码下载到本地,解压后即可查看。
2、配置环境:安装PHP、MySQL、Apache等环境。
3、数据库配置:修改config.php文件中的数据库配置信息。
4、运行网站:将网站根目录放置到Apache的虚拟主机目录下,访问即可。
这个精美PHP个人网站源码集成了多种功能,代码结构清晰,易于维护,通过学习和使用这个源码,可以深入了解PHP编程和网站开发,提高自己的技能水平,希望本文的揭秘能够对大家有所帮助。
标签: #精美的php个人网站源码
评论列表